2 | . Repairing, converting or salvaging: |
This subclass is indented under subclass 1. Method including (A) restoring or reconditioning an inoperative
electric lamp or electric space discharge device to its functional,
stable, or working condition; or (B) altering or modifying an electric
lamp or electric space discharge device to produce a lamp or device
of substantially different capacity, size, function, or type of
operation; or (C) recovering or reclaiming a portion of an electric
lamp or electric space discharge device that would otherwise be
discarded.

28 | .. Flash lamp, X-ray tube or laser making: |
This subclass is indented under subclass 23. Method for fabricating or manufacturing a device that, (1)
produces bursts of light of short duration and high intensity such
as are used for photography, or (2) produces a penetrating electromagnetic
radiation known as roentgen rays such as by accelerating electrons
to high velocity and suddenly stopping them by collision with a
solid target or body, or (3) produces a narrow beam of coherent,
powerful and nearly monochromatic electromagnetic radiation using
the laser principle of light amplifications by stimulated emission
of radiation, i.e., LASER.

30 | ... CRT mask mounting: |
This subclass is indented under subclass 29. Method including attaching or manipulating a perforated
panel or equivalent arrangement located adjacent the screen of a
cathode ray tube to delineate the path of various electron or light
beams within the tube as in a color television picture tube.
